Student travel insurance provides coverage to students traveling for academic purposes. These plans are designed to protect students from unfortunate events, including medical emergencies, COVID-19 treatment, medical evacuations, repatriation, hospital visits, trip-related risks, and more that can occur while travelling. 

Depending on the policy, it may also provide benefits such as mental health, pregnancy, acute onset of pre-existing conditions, and other add-on benefits. So, why do you need a student travel insurance plan? 

1. To protect you from medical emergencies. 

Insurance coverage for medical emergencies refers to the benefits and protection provided by an insurance policy when an unexpected medical emergency occurs. In case you become severely ill or have a fatal accident, you need to be taken to the hospital. Medical expenses can be exorbitantly high, which is unaffordable for many. 

Students travelling to and in the US for studies may go bankrupt if they start paying for medical expenses from their pockets. This is when you need a student travel insurance plan. The plan covers you up to the chosen policy maximum so that you do not worry about paying the bills for hospitals, urgent care, doctor’s visits., lab and diagnostic tests, surgeries, and prescription drugs. 

2. To cover you against travel-related adversities. 

Trip cancellation, trip interruption, trip delays, rental car and theft coverage, lost or delayed baggage, loss of passport and personal belongings, and other travel-related risks can occur anytime. If you are not lucky abroad, you may face huge monetary loss, followed by stress and anxiety. To avoid these circumstances, you can buy a student travel insurance plan and keep yourself protected. 

You can use trip cancellation coverage to protect your non-refundable trip costs in case you must cancel the trip for a covered reason as mentioned in the policy. Trip interruption insurance provides coverage if you need to cut your trip short due to unforeseen circumstances, such as a family emergency or a natural disaster. Your plan can help reimburse you for the costs of returning home early and any non-refundable insured costs of your trip that were unused. 

Lost or delayed baggage insurance provides coverage if your luggage is lost, stolen, or delayed during your trip. Your plan can reimburse you for the cost of replacing necessary items and can provide coverage for the cost of temporary items or as stated in the policy. 

3. To utilize coverage for emergency services. 

Emergency local ambulance, medical evacuation, emergency reunion, interfacility ambulance transfer, political evacuation, and repatriation, and return of mortal remains are some emergency services that you may need coverage for. There can be events where you need an emergency local ambulance to take you to the nearest qualified medical facility, which can cost you thousands of dollars. 

When you have a student travel insurance plan, you can utilize the emergency service coverage and get yourself financially covered. In case you need to be transferred to your home country, you can utilize repatriation coverage. However, not all plans will offer the same emergency services coverage. Check the brochure to understand the schedule of benefits. 

4. To get yourself covered for mental disorders. 

Student travel insurance plans offer mental and psychological disorders coverage so that students can visit a psychiatrist if they go through any kind of mental trouble. The plan can cover you for medical treatment, doctor’s visits, drugs, and follow-ups. There can be limitations, which you can find in the plan’s document. 

Being away from your family and support system can be challenging for students, and they can face severe panic and anxiety while living in an unfamiliar land. Hence, these plans can act as your support. Some plans can also provide virtual counseling and therapy. 

5. To get coverage for dental pain. 

Typically, the policies cover dental pain or traumatic injury to a sound natural tooth. The policies do not cover dental issues that you already have been worked on, or you are taking medications for it. For instance, if you lose a sound natural tooth or need dental surgery for an accident, the policy may cover it.
